fring DID work w/ Skype video. Skype stopped that party in 2010. Did fring sit and cry? No way. They re-invented themselves. Group video calls work on iPhone n Android w/ fring, says Techistan.

Fring has fringout! Call w/ your cell phone using fring internationally starting at one US cent per minute. Currently it works on the N60 (symbian) and soon on Android and iPhone devices. True!
